    im trying to update the aspi layer in my xp system to version4.71.2, i follow the instructions that adaptec gives but it will not install here are their instructions

    Installation Instruction:
    This file extracts by default to the c:\adaptec\ directory. If you have changed this directory, please note the directory you have chosen. For Windows 98, NT 4.0, Me and 2000, use the enclosed ASPIINST.EXE file to install the ASPI layer. For Windows XP, select Start - Run from the menu, and then the Browse button. Locate the INSTALL.BAT file in the directory the files extracted to and select the OPEN button. In the command box, add a space and either XP32 for Pentium I/II/III/IV processors or XP64 for Itanium processors. The command should look like: c:\adaptec\aspi\install XP32 or c:\adaptec\aspi\install.bat XP64. Then select the OK button to run the XP installer

    now everything works good untill i execute the batch file in which i get the following screen (below).i cannot type in the correct command line in the given instructions because whenever i do the dos windowed box just disapears.what am i doing wrong?

    "INSTALL.BAT <Operating System Type>"
    "--------------------------------------"
    "X86 - Microsoft Windows 98/ME/NT/2000"
    "XP32 - Microsoft Windows XP X86"
    "XP64 - Microsoft Windows XP Itanium"
    Press any key to continue . . .

    sorry.but thats what i cant get to work.when at the prompt as soon as i type any key in, the dos box disapears and i have to restart the bat file.ive downloaded the prog from 3 diff sites still same prob.how cani enter install xp32 when the dos box keeps closing?any more ideas

    LOL.. go to command prompt from the START button in your lower left hand; then, go to browse, and find that bat file. Now pick it, then just type in xp32; hit return. The reason why its closing is becuz u are trying to run it when u DOUBLE click on the bat file itself..it doesnt work that way.
